Hal Blackadar was appointed Corus' Vice President of Human Resources in April, 2002. Previously, he was Vice President, Ontario for Corus Radio and has been with Corus and its predecessor company Shaw Communications since 1995. Mr. Blackadar has also served as a manager of joint radio properties in Halifax, Ottawa and Toronto, and as President of Maclean Hunter's Radio division for the Ontario region. He has also served as Director of the United Way of Canada, Chairman of Oakwood Terrace Senior Care Facility, and the Royal Ottawa Hospital Foundation. Other Board positions have included Director of the Radio Marketing Bureau of Canada and the Foundation to Assist Canadian Artists on Record (FACTOR). Mr. Blackadar is a founding member of the digital radio rollout committee for Canada, and has held responsibilities for the operations of 102.1 The Edge and Energy 108 on behalf of Shaw Radio Ltd.

Mr. Bragg, 64, is a director of Sobey's Inc., Empire Company Limited and the Toronto-Dominion Bank. He has served on the boards of many Canadian companies including Imasco Ltd., Shaw Communications Inc. and Maritime Life Assurance Co. He is President of a number of companies including Bragg Lumber Co., Ltd., and Cherryfield Foods Inc. and Chairman of several Canadian and U.S. companies including Bragg Communications Inc., EastLink Cable Systems, and BioSan Laboratories Inc. Mr. Bragg is an Officer of the Order of Canada and the Chancellor of Mount Allison University. Mr. Bragg is Chairman of the Audit Committee and a member of the Human Resources and Corporate Governance Committee.
